Guoji Zibai pan

The Guoji Zibai pan (simplified Chinese: 虢季子白盘; traditional Chinese: 虢季子白盤; pinyin: Guójì Zǐbaí Pán) is an ancient Chinese bronze rectangular pan vessel from the Western Zhou dynasty (1046 BC–771 BC). Excavated in Chencang District of Baoji, Shaanxi during the Daoguang era (1821–1851) of the Qing dynasty (1644–1911), it is on display in the National Museum of China in Beijing.
